Jobs at Precisely
About this Opportunity
Application and Interview Impersonation Notice: Impersonating another individual when applying for employment, and/or participating in an interview process to assist another individual in obtaining employment, with Precisely Software Incorporated (“Precisely”) is unlawful. If Precisely identifies such fraudulent conduct, then as applicable and to the extent permitted by law, the application will be rejected, an offer (if made) will be rescinded, or the employment will be terminated, and legal action may be taken against the impersonators.
Precisely is the leader in data integrity. We empower businesses to make more confident decisions based on trusted data through a unique combination of software, data enrichment products and strategic services. What does this mean to you? For starters, it means joining a company focused on delivering outstanding innovation and support that helps customers increase revenue, lower costs and reduce risk. In fact, Precisely powers better decisions for more than 12,000 global organizations, including 95 of the Fortune 100. Precisely's 2500 employees are unified by four company core values that are central to who we are and how we operate: Openness, Determination, Individuality, and Collaboration. We are committed to career development for our employees and offer opportunities for growth, learning and building community. With a "work from anywhere" culture, we celebrate diversity in a distributed environment with a presence in 30 countries as well as 20 offices in over 5 continents. Learn more about why it's an exciting time to join Precisely!
As a Software Engineer in a product development organization, you will be part of the team that designs and develops .Net applications in the enterprise domain. You will collaborate with architects, product managers and other software developers for developing products features. You are expected to be hands on in .Net and up to date with the latest development technologies such as C#, .Net, Angular, REST API, etc.
Design, develop, and maintain scalable .NET applications
Write unit tests and implement UI/API automation tests
Collaborate with team members and cross-functional teams to deliver product features
Independently analyze and resolve software issues in collaboration with technical staff
Address customer-reported issues and contribute to product improvements and enhancements
Contribute to design optimizations, performance tuning, and future technical initiatives
Proactively identify risks and support early mitigation strategies
Improve code quality and address non-functional requirements such as performance, scalability, and reliability
Perform code reviews and help improve engineering processes
Assist in the development of software documentation and user manuals
1–3 years of experience in software development with a strong product development background
A BE/BTech/MCA or equivalent degree in Computer Science or a related technical field from an accredited institution
Good understanding of design and architectural patterns with hands-on application experience
Experience in developing and consuming REST APIs for modern, scalable web applications
Strong knowledge of .NET and C#
Experience with cloud databases such as MongoDB
Good knowledge of the latest Angular framework
Strong understanding of SQL Server, including writing SQL scripts and stored procedures
Experience with AWS services, API Gateway, MongoDB, and Kafka will be an added advantage
Knowledge of Google Add-ons will be a plus
Basic knowledge of SAP is a plus
The personal data that you provide as a part of this job application will be handled in accordance with relevant laws
Find the perfect job!
Use Job Hunt AI to find the perfect job for you.